The Iridium Acetate (Reagent) market's growth is primarily fueled by the increasing demand for highly efficient and selective catalysts in various chemical processes. The unique catalytic properties of iridium acetate, such as its ability to facilitate C-H activation and cross-coupling reactions, make it an invaluable tool in organic synthesis. This demand is particularly strong in the pharmaceutical industry, where complex molecules require precise and efficient synthesis methods. The growing focus on developing novel drugs and therapies further accelerates the need for sophisticated catalytic reagents like iridium acetate. Moreover, advancements in nanotechnology and materials science are creating new applications for iridium acetate. For instance, its use in the synthesis of advanced materials with unique properties is becoming increasingly prevalent. The expanding research and development activities in the field of catalysis, coupled with ongoing efforts to improve the sustainability of chemical processes, are also contributing to the market's growth. The growing preference for green chemistry approaches, emphasizing the use of environmentally benign catalysts, positions iridium acetate favorably, stimulating its demand across multiple sectors.
Despite the promising growth outlook, the Iridium Acetate (Reagent) market faces certain challenges. The primary constraint is the high cost of iridium, a precious metal, which directly impacts the price of the reagent. This makes it less accessible to smaller companies or those operating with tighter budgets. Furthermore, the supply chain for iridium can be unpredictable, vulnerable to geopolitical factors and mining limitations, leading to price volatility. Stringent environmental regulations surrounding the handling and disposal of iridium compounds also pose a challenge for manufacturers and users. These regulations add to the overall cost and complexity of using iridium acetate, requiring specialized equipment and procedures for safe handling. The competitive landscape, with several players offering similar products, necessitates continuous innovation and cost optimization to maintain market share. The potential emergence of more cost-effective and equally efficient alternative catalysts also presents a challenge to iridium acetate's dominance in the market.
